The price of uPVC double-glazed windows can differ based on the style, material, and size you choose. Fixed windows are not able to open, and can cost between PS150 and PS300 per window. Sliding windows open by sliding horizontally from one or more sides. They are more expensive, and can range between PS450 and PS1000.

Many local and national windows companies have a number of programs to help lower the cost of installing double glazing in your home. These include the ECO4 energy grant and LA Flex. The ECO4 scheme is designed to help homeowners on lower incomes pay for energy-saving upgrades, including double glazing. LA Flex provides financial assistance to those who aren't able to meet the ECO4 requirements.

Triple-glazed double-glazed windows that provide a more effective quality of noise reduction and insulation. This kind of window has an additional pane insulated by an inert, such as argon, or Krypton. This helps to prevent loss of heat. Additionally you can select from a range of coatings to further increase the insulation.
Another alternative is aluminium double-glazed windows, which have an elegant and slimmer frame. These windows are robust and weatherproof, and they can be designed to fit the style of your home. These windows are available in many different shades to match any design. They are more expensive than uPVC, but they can save you money in the long term.
Timber double-glazed windows are also a popular option. They are made from sustainable wood and are much more eco-friendly than uPVC. They are available in a variety of styles ranging from bay to sash and can be stained or painted to match your home.
